About the role

Pine Rest is a non-profit behavioral health system committed to providing expert care for mental health and substance use disorders. The Safety & Security Officer role is part of a tight-knit team dedicated to ensuring the safety and security of the facility, its staff, patients, and visitors.

Responsibilities

  • Maintain the overall security and safety of the facility, protecting patients, employees, and property.
  • Perform surveillance and scheduled rounding, reporting any incidents.
  • Enforce safety and security policies, respond to emergencies, and complete contraband checks.
  • Create a positive, customer-friendly environment and provide excellent customer service.
  • Participate in safety programs, identify risks, and promote patient and environmental safety.
  • Respond to Code calls and provide safe transport for patients or staff as needed.
  • Crisis response leadership including standard communication protocols internally and externally.
  • Liaison with Kent County Sheriff Department and all other law enforcement.
  • Maintain records, enter data, and generate reports using computer systems.
  • Use resources responsibly and provide input on procedural efficiency.
  • Serve involuntary paperwork accurately and maintain direct patient contact within the scope of the position.
  • Model the organization's mission and values, providing comprehensive support to patients.
  • Train new employees, participate in meetings, and serve on committees, as required.
  • Maintain annual training and demonstrate competency in required programs including drills.
  • Provide backup for switchboard emergency procedures as needed.
